A ^<19> F NMR STUDY OF 2-DEOXY-2-FLUORO-D-GALACTOSE IN MICE

The metabolic pathway of 2-deoxy-2-fluoro-D-galactose (FDGal) in mice was studied by ^<19>F NMR. Efficient accumulation of FDGal in liver was demonstrated by NMR, which is consistent with the results of Ishiwata et al. using radioactive ^<18>FDGal.The new discovery is that this fluorinated hexose was converted to 2-deoxy-2-fluoro-D-glucose (FDG) through UDP-FDGal and UDP-FDG apparently by the action of UDP-Gal epimerase.
